Problem
Current wireless communication systems face challenges in efficiently managing sidelink positioning procedures, particularly in congested networks where excessive network resources are utilized for query-based procedures and anchor configuration.
Innovation Solution
A method where a base station provides a threshold value for a sidelink positioning procedure, and mobile stations autonomously determine their suitability to anchor the procedure based on this threshold, thereby dynamically controlling which UEs can perform sidelink positioning.

Various aspects of the present disclosure generally relate to wireless communication. In some aspects, a mobile station may receive first information identifying a value for a threshold parameter associated with a sidelink positioning procedure. The mobile station may transmit second information identifying a suitability for anchoring the sidelink positioning procedure, wherein the suitability is associated with the value for the threshold parameter.
